Transaction 3670aed2c06344943cde1860e7c0e773555d2564192eadbbee4111f1827ead3f
1 Input
1 Output
-
3670aed2c06344943cde1860e7c0e773555d2564192eadbbee4111f1827ead3f:0
- value
- 31677881
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ec9d3580eeb9da1d3f0e00e69f05a0fe8cc3aac
- address
- bc1q8myaxkqwaww6r5lsuq8xnuz6pl5vcw4vnhyawj